Subject: Key rotation + that websocket reconnect fix

Hi,

Welcome aboard! Quick heads-up: we rotated the keys for the Driftline gateway this morning. This ties into the websocket reconnect bug you'll be poking at — clients were reconnecting with stale tokens after a drop, which made the bug look worse than it was. The fix in branch reconnect-backoff should land once you can repro against staging. Old keys die Friday, so update your local env now. Here's the new staging key for the Driftline internal API.

gateway credential: kto3_qfe

Internal Memo — Project Silverbrake Delay

To: Sales Leads, Marnix Systems

The Silverbrake pricing-tool rollout is delayed six weeks due to integration defects found in regression testing. Interim quoting procedures remain in force; please ensure teams continue using the current workbook. A revised schedule will follow after Friday's readiness review. The confidential business-planning note relevant to this delay appears directly below.

confidential, bageg-bahap: Only 9 of the 80 pilot accounts renewed Wenael, so a churn review is set for April 15.

## Service accounts: payment retries

The retry-runner service account replays failed charges through Ledgermint using idempotency keys derived from the original transaction hash, so duplicate charges are impossible even across restarts. Never retry with a fresh idempotency key unless the original charge is confirmed voided. The runner authenticates to the internal payments gateway with the key shown below.

app token of bawep-hafog = kto7_vwrmnlx

**Key ceremony item — Meadowline reminder job**

☐ Confirm the signing key for the Meadowline clinic appointment reminder job was rotated and the old key revoked. Verify one test reminder renders correctly against the staging roster before sign-off. Store the new key shard in the ceremony safe; the shard envelope is sealed with the passphrase below.

recovery phrase for tagag-tadug: caswyn-ralwyn